September 2008 Update

Vocational Academy now government recognized school

Our Vocational Academy is now a governemnt recognized school and we are elegible to run a school upto 8th class. Please click here for the latest news about our academy, pictures from the nearly finished construction work and our future plans.

First report from our relief team in Bihar

Please click here to read the first report of our relief team which set off to Birhar on the 8th of September.

The extend of the problem is so huge that it is impossible for govt. or any other agencies to provide all the necessary support. The joint effort for humanity is required. From our side we try to contribute by starting the Rehabilitation Project of flood affected HANUMAN PATTI Village in Purnia District (Bihar). Urgent help required for flood victims in Bihar in India

Bihar, one of the poorest states in India, is struck by the biggest flood ever. DFoundation is planning to send a team of 12 volunteers which include a doctor, a cook and other relief workers. Urgent help needed for Roshani

Roshani needs urgent medical treatment as initial diagnosis shows that her heart and lever are damage. Roshani is second eldest among five orphans we adopted in Panpapur. Her treatment is going on in Apollo Hospital (one of the best hospitals in Varanasi). The initial treatment costs around 25 thousand Ruppee.
